Meaning and definitions of petunia, translation in Chinese language for petunia with similar and opposite words. Also find spoken pronunciation of petunia in Chinese and in English language.
What petunia means in Chinese, petunia meaning in Chinese, petunia definition, examples and pronunciation of petunia in Chinese language.